Current location - Education and Training Encyclopedia - Education and training - Is it necessary to learn mysql?
Is it necessary to learn mysql?
Mysql is worth learning.

1, MySQL overview?

MySQL is an open source relational database management system (RDBMS), which uses SQL (Structured Query Language) as its operating language. MySQL has powerful performance, reliability and ease of use, and is widely used in various applications and websites.

2.MySQL application scenario?

MySQL is widely used in Web development, enterprise application, data processing, cloud computing and other fields. It can support high concurrent access, persistent storage and * * * access, making MySQL the first choice for many enterprises and developers.

3. Analysis of advantages and disadvantages of 3.MySQL?

MySQL has many advantages, such as fast processing of a large number of data, strong expansibility, high stability, and supporting a large number of concurrent user connections. However, MySQL also has some shortcomings, such as not being strong enough in dealing with unstructured data and not fully supporting complex queries.

4. How to learn MySQL?

There are many ways to learn MySQL, such as reading official documents, consulting online tutorials and attending training courses. The best way to learn is to master various operations and skills of MySQL through practice in combination with actual projects. In addition, you can also pay attention to professional blogs, websites and communities in MySQL field to understand the latest trends and technical progress.

MySQL database has the characteristics of open source code, high availability and high performance.

1, open source code

MySQL is open source and can be used for free. Its community has contributed many open source components and plug-ins, which have made great progress in security, performance and function.

2. High availability

MySQL supports a variety of highly available architectures, such as master-slave replication, master-slave replication, strict replication, etc., which can make the system switch between master and standby quickly without affecting the business and ensure that data is not lost.

3. High performance

MySQL uses many performance optimization techniques, such as table partitioning, data fragmentation and index optimization, which can easily cope with large-scale data processing and high concurrent access scenarios, providing fast response and excellent performance.